The Lithuania Wood Tar Market experienced a peak size of €0.62 million in 2023, with a subsequent decline to €0.28 million in 2024. The market is forecasted to continue shrinking, reaching €0.03 million by 2030, with a CAGR of -30.0% from 2025 to 2030. In the Lithuania Wood Tar Market, exports experienced fluctuations over the years, starting at €106.47 thousand in 2019, decreasing sharply to €22.5 thousand in 2020, and gradually recovering to €66.15 thousand by 2025. Imports, on the other hand, followed a different trajectory, rising consistently from €101.58 thousand in 2019 to a peak of €619.89 thousand in 2022 before declining to €53.76 thousand in 2025. The market witnessed a notable surge in exports in 2024, reaching €53.62 thousand, attributed to increased demand for wood tar products in various industries. Conversely, the sharp decline in imports in 2024, to €71.52 thousand, could be due to shifts in sourcing strategies or changes in domestic production capabilities.
